Overview

For buyers prioritizing budget and value, the Suzuki Alto Sport presents a significant cost advantage over the Daihatsu Mira. The average listed price of the Alto Sport at LKR 4,425,000 is notably lower than the Mira’s average price of LKR 5,715,000, offering potential savings in both purchase and maintenance costs. This substantial difference means that the Alto Sport provides reliable daily transportation while keeping budget constraints firmly in mind.

In terms of practical differences, the Daihatsu Mira is typically positioned as a highly compact vehicle designed for maximum urban maneuverability and utility, often favored for its small footprint. Conversely, the Suzuki Alto Sport generally offers a slightly more robust segment feel and potentially better road stability suitable for varied Sri Lankan roads. Both are reliable hatchbacks from 2016 models, but their differing design philosophies affect where they perform best.

Considering overall value versus pure economy, the Mira is ideal for those needing extreme compactness in highly congested areas, while the Alto Sport represents a more accessible and arguably better all-rounder choice for general family use around Colombo and beyond.
